Method

Preparation of Marinade

1

Make the Marinade

In a bowl, combine the olive oil, minced garlic, chopped rosemary, chopped thyme, salt, black pepper, and lemon juice. Mix well to create a marinade.

Marinating the Steak

2

Marinate the Steak

Place the bone-in ribeye steak in a large resealable plastic b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the steak, ensuring it is well coated. Seal the bag or cover the dish, and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or overnight for best results.

Cooking the Steak

3

Grill the Steak

Preheat your grill to high heat. Remove the steak from the marinade and let it come to room temperature (about 30 minutes). Place the steak on the grill and cook for 7-10 minutes on each side for medium-rare, adjusting the time depending on your desired doneness.

4

Rest the Steak

Once cooked to your liking, remove the steak from the grill and let it rest for 10 minutes before slicing. This allows the juices to redistribute.

Preparing Sides

5

Roast Vegetables (optional)

While the steak is resting, you can roast vegetables as a side. Toss your choice of chopped vegetables in olive oil, salt, and pepper, then roast in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) for about 20-25 minutes until tender.

Serving

6

Serve the Steak

Slice the steak against the grain and serve it on a platter. Garnish with fresh herbs and optional roasted vegetables on the side.
